Permanent Way Institution (PWI) formally changes name

The Permanent Way Institution (Incorporated) has formally changed its name to the Railway Engineering Institution (Incorporated), PWI becoming RailEI. This milestone marks an important evolution for the Institution, reflecting both the breadth of railway engineering disciplines it supports and its role as a modern, inclusive Professional Engineering Institution licensed by the UK Engineering Council. DB Cargo UK agrees sale of Class 66 locos to Grup Feroviar Roman

DB Cargo UK has agreed to sell 25 Class 66 locomotives to Romania’s largest private railway company, Grup Feroviar Roman (GFR).
